About the Science Museum

London's Science Museum is one of the capital's most popular tourist attractions, receiving over three million visitors per year. Founded back in 1857, the museum has stayed current by updating exhibits with the latest and greatest in scientific know-how and discovery. It's a popular place for both adults and kids to learn more about the world we live in and the history of science that has revealed it to us.

Some of the museum's more famous exhibits include Stephenson's Rocket steam engine, the first jet engine ever built, and the Apollo 10 command module. The museum is also known for its interactive exhibits that make education fun, along with an IMAX theater to bring documentaries to life.

The museum also organizes adults-only events on the last Wednesday of every month. These can be lectures, film screenings, or even silent discos.

The Science Museum is located in London's trendy Kensington district. This puts it close not only to a selection of other interesting museums, but also means you'll find world-class shopping, dining, and other attractions close by.

Things to do near the Science Museum

With its interactive exhibits and many themed galleries, the Science Museum can keep you and your family entertained for at least a day, if not several. But thanks to the area the museum is in, there's plenty to do outside of its doors too. Kensington is an area well worth exploring, and the Science Museum is just one of its many attractions. You could also:

  • Spend some cash at Portobello market. London is home to countless open-air markets, but the one on Portobello Road is one of the most iconic. Known as the world's largest antiques market, over 1,000 stalls sell just about everything under the sun at this lively London attraction.
  • Explore the lives of royalty at Kensington Palace. The current home of Prince William, the heir to the British throne, Kensington Palace is open to the public. You can explore the fabulously decorated rooms and exquisite art galleries, or wander in the well-manicured gardens that make up one of London's best city parks.
  • Take in some culture at the Victoria and Albert Museum. Just steps from the Science Museum, the Victoria and Albert has one of the world's most extensive collections of sculpture. Devoted to the decorative arts, it is home to priceless masterpieces along with quirky exhibits of the everyday.
  • Go shopping at Harrods. This legendary department store is known for luxury brands and exceptional customer service. Even if you can't afford the price tags here, it's still worth a visit just to see how London's wealthy live.

Transit options near the Science Museum

  • South Kensington Underground station is connected to the Science Museum by a pedestrian walkway. The station is served by the District, Circle, and Piccadilly lines.
  • South Kensington station lies on many London bus routes, including 14, 49, 70, 74, and others.
  • Transport London operates a rental bike docking station outside the museum, making it easy to reach on the city's network of public rental bikes.

Activities and attractions near the Science Museum

  • Natural History Museum: Another Kensington institution, this museum attracts millions of visitors per year. The huge collection of specimens here, including an intact blue whale skeleton in its own magnificent hall, is sure to make an impression on anyone, young or old. Be aware that the museum does not allow large bags, so it's best to drop off your baggage at a London luggage storage shop before you visit.
  • Hyde Park:. The Serpentine is the waterway that runs through this green space, and you can rent rowboats and pedal boats to explore under your own steam. If that sounds like too much work, the Serpentine is also home to the Solarshuttle, a 40 passenger boat that glides across the water powered only by the sun.
